One day Mary went to visit Louise.
The little city girl had never been
in the country before.
She liked to see the lambs play.
One evening the girls went to walk.
They were walking near the sheep pen.
"Look at that strange dog!" said Mary.
"See what a sharp nose he has!
His ears are pointed, too.
See how bushy his tail is!"
Louise looked at the strange dog
and laughed.
"That is not a dog," she said.
"That is a coyote. I'll call Turk to
drive him away."
Turk ran after the coyote and barked.
The coyote ran off very fast.
In the night Mary heard a strange
cry.
"What is that?" she asked Louise.
"It is the coyote," said Louise.
"He is crying for his supper."
